One couple's wedding in Havre de Grace over the weekend was spoiled by a thief who made off with a box of cash-filled envelopes during the reception.
The couple was celebrating with a reception at about 1 p.m. on Saturday outside the Havre de Grace Decoy Museum, in the 100 block of Lafayette Street, when an unknown woman emptied a chest of cards filled with cash for the newlyweds, Ofc. Jeff Gilpin of Havre de Grace Police Department said.
Police are still looking for the thief, who is described as a white woman with curly blonde hair, wearing a white tank top and shorts or Capri pants.
"It ruined their whole wedding," Gilpin said Tuesday. "It's a shame that these folks' wedding had to be interrupted by someone with selfish needs."
